文章揭秘.NET Core单例模式注入:高效编程利器,轻松实现依赖管理
在.NET Core开发中,单例模式注入是依赖注入(Dependency Injection,简称DI)的一个重要组成部分。它允许我们在整个应用程序中重用同一个实例,同时保持实例的唯一性。本文将详细介绍.NET Core中的单例模式注...
在.NET Core开发中,单例模式注入是依赖注入(Dependency Injection,简称DI)的一个重要组成部分。它允许我们在整个应用程序中重用同一个实例,同时保持实例的唯一性。本文将详细介绍.NET Core中的单例模式注...
引言 在Java开发中,单例模式和依赖注入是两个非常重要的概念。它们不仅能够提高代码的可维护性和可测试性,还能让开发过程更加高效。本文将深入探讨Spring框架中的单例模式和依赖注入,并分析它们如何为Java开发带来便利。 单例模式 ...
在Java的Spring框架中,Bean注入是一种常见的依赖管理方式。通常情况下,Spring默认使用单例模式来管理Bean的生命周期。然而,在某些场景下,可能需要使用非单例的Bean来提供更灵活的依赖管理。本文将揭秘Bean注入非单...
在Spring框架中,单例注入是最常见的依赖注入方式,但有时候,为了满足特定的业务需求,我们可能需要使用非单例注入。非单例注入意味着在Spring容器中,同一个Bean可能会有多个实例。这种方式虽然灵活,但也带来了不少艺术与挑战。本文...
引言 单例模式是软件设计模式中的一种,其目的是确保一个类只有一个实例,并提供一个全局访问点。然而,在依赖注入(DI)框架中,单例模式往往会引发一系列问题,因为依赖注入通常依赖于构造函数注入或设置器注入。本文将深入探讨单例模式注入的难题...
在Java开发中,依赖注入(Dependency Injection,DI)是一种常用的设计模式,它有助于实现松耦合的代码,提高代码的可测试性和可维护性。Spring框架作为Java企业级应用开发的事实标准,提供了强大的依赖注入功能。...
在Spring框架中,依赖注入(DI)是核心特性之一,它允许开发者将对象的创建和依赖关系的管理交给Spring容器。Spring默认使用单例模式来创建Bean,这意味着每个Bean在Spring容器中只有一个实例。然而,在某些场景下,...
单例模式和依赖注入是软件开发中常见的两种设计模式,它们各自在软件架构中扮演着重要角色。本文将深入探讨这两种模式的融合,分析如何通过它们的结合来提升代码质量与可维护性。 单例模式概述 单例模式是一种确保一个类只有一个实例,并提供一个全局...
Java作为一门广泛应用于企业级开发的语言,依赖管理是其核心之一。在Java开发中,依赖注入(Dependency Injection,简称DI)是一种常用的设计模式,用于实现类之间的解耦。而JavaBean的单例和多例模式则是实现依...
在现代软件开发中,依赖注入(Dependency Injection,简称DI)是一种常见的编程范式,它有助于提高代码的可维护性和可测试性。在多例场景下,如何正确地注入单例是一个值得探讨的问题。本文将深入解析多例中注入单例的奥秘,帮助...
在软件工程中,依赖注入(Dependency Injection,DI)和单例模式(Singleton Pattern)是两种常见的软件设计模式。它们各自以不同的方式影响着应用的架构和代码的可维护性。本文将深入探讨依赖注入与单例模式,...
在Spring框架中,单例注入和多例注入是两种常见的依赖注入方式。它们在实现代码解耦、提高代码可维护性方面起着至关重要的作用。本文将深入探讨这两种注入方式的原理、应用场景以及在实际开发中的注意事项。 单例注入 单例注入的原理 单例注入...